Structure of the Day #5-Empire State Building

    The Empire State Building in New York City, New York, United States, was built in 1931.  With 102 floors the Empire State Building stands 1,250 feet tall or 381 meters.  After the September 11th attacks which totally destroyed the World Trade Center towers, it became New York City's tallest building.  It approximately weighs 340,000 tons and costed $40,948,900 to complete.












 





      The Empire State Building is listed as one of the Seven Wonders of the Modern World.  This building is and always will be one of America's greatest structures!
